어쩌면 일지

Chat GPT를 활용한 번역 시스템 본문

[AI,코딩]

Chat GPT를 활용한 번역 시스템

조아라세연 2023. 4. 12. 18:01
728x90

Nightcafe studio로 생성한 이미지입니다.

Chat GPT 사용하여 다국어 번역 시스템을 구현하는 방법

 

데이터 수집 :

먼저 번역에 필요한 데이터를 수집한다. 이는 번역에 사용될 언어에 따라 다양하다다.

예를 들어 영한 번역 시스템의 경우, 영어와 한국어의 병렬 말뭉치 데이터를 수집해야 한다. 이때 데이터의 양과 질이 모델의 성능에 큰 영향을 미치므로, 가능한 한 많은 데이터를 수집하고, 중복 데이터나 잘못된 데이터를 제거하는 등의 전처리 작업을 수행한다.

 

데이터 전처리 :

수집한 데이터를 정제하고 전처리한다. 이는 데이터 크기를 줄이고, 중복 데이터를 제거하고, 데이터를 교정하는 등의 작업을 수행한다.

대부분의 번역 시스템은 토큰화(tokenization)이나 정규화(normalization)과 같은 과정을 거쳐 데이터를 처리한다. 이때 각 언어에 대한 특수한 규칙이 존재하기 때문에, 해당 언어에 맞는 전처리 기술을 사용해야 한다.

 

모델 학습 :

Chat GPT 모델을 선택하고 학습시킨다. 이를 위해 전처리된 데이터를 모델에 적용하여 모델을 학습시킨다.

모델 학습은 크게 두 가지 단계로 이루어진다. 먼저 모델을 초기화하고, 초기 가중치를 설정한다. 그 다음 학습 데이터를 모델에 적용하면서 모델의 가중치를 업데이트한다. 이 과정을 반복한다.

 

모델 평가 :

학습된 모델을 평가하고 성능을 개선한다. 이를 위해 모델의 정확도와 성능을 평가하고, 결과를 분석하여 개선 작업을 수행한다. 이 과정에서는 모델이 잘못된 예측을 하는 경우, 이를 수정하거나 추가적인 학습 데이터를 수집하여 모델의 정확도를 개선할 수 있다.

 

배포 :

마지막으로 모델을 서비스에 배포하고, 사용자의 요청에 따라 번역을 수행한다. 이를 위해서는 적절한 인터페이스나 API를 제공해야 한다.

 

 

활용 사례

 

1. 온라인 쇼핑: 다국어 번역 시스템을 이용하여 해외 온라인 쇼핑몰에서 상품 정보를 번역해 손쉽게 검색할 있다.

 

2. 외국어 학습: Chat GPT 이용한 번역 시스템을 활용하여 외국어 학습에 활용할 있다.

 

3. 비즈니스 커뮤니케이션: Chat GPT 사용하여 비즈니스 메일이나 문서를 다른 언어로 번역하여 해외 거래 파트너와 손쉽게 소통할 있다.

 

4. 여행: 해외 여행 다국어 번역 시스템을 이용하여 음식, 교통, 문화 등의 정보를 손쉽게 이해할 있다.

728x90
Comments